Trump Appoints Todd Blanche as Department of Justice Interim Head – Crypto News Bitcoin News

April 3, 2026No Comments2 Mins Read

New DOJ Interim Chief Linked to Crypto Enforcement Shift

President Donald Trump has appointed Todd Blanche as the interim U.S. Attorney General, replacing Pam Bondi in a move that could shape the future of crypto enforcement in the United States.

Blanche, who previously served as Trump’s defense lawyer in a New York criminal case, had been acting as deputy attorney general before his appointment. His tenure has already had a clear impact on the Department of Justice’s approach to digital assets.

Earlier this year, Blanche ordered the shutdown of the DOJ’s National Cryptocurrency Enforcement Team. The unit, created in 2022, focused on investigating illicit crypto activity. He also issued guidance instructing prosecutors to avoid pursuing cases centered on regulatory violations within the crypto sector.

That shift has already influenced active cases. In the Southern District of New York, prosecutors dropped one charge against Tornado Cash developer Roman Storm after referencing Blanche’s directive. Storm still faces additional legal proceedings later this year.

Blanche’s appointment is likely to reinforce a more restrained enforcement approach toward crypto. Supporters see this as a move toward clearer boundaries between regulation and criminal prosecution. Critics, however, warn that it could weaken oversight in a rapidly evolving market.

His personal financial disclosures have added another layer of controversy. According to a July 2025 filing, Blanche transferred crypto holdings to family members before taking office. The assets included bitcoin, ethereum, solana, and other tokens, along with shares in Coinbase.

However, reports indicate he still held between $159,000 and $485,000 in crypto when he signed the enforcement memo. That raises potential ethical concerns, as officials are expected to divest before handling matters involving their financial interests.

The leadership change comes at a time when the U.S. is reassessing its stance on digital assets. With enforcement priorities shifting and regulatory clarity still evolving, Blanche’s role could prove influential in shaping the next phase of crypto policy.
